The Blob to Blame For Declining Pacific Cod Stocks in Gulf of Alaska, Says NOAA
SEAFOODNEWS.COM [Alaska Public Media] by Aaron Bolton - November 7, 2017
Last month, the North Pacific Fishery Management Council, which regulates groundfish in Alaska and other federal fisheries, received some shocking news. Pacific cod stocks in the Gulf of Alaska may have declined as much as 70 percent over the past two years. That estimate is a preliminary figure, but it leaves plenty of questions about the future of cod fishing in Gulf of Alaska ...
